Delivered in 2007, Anavi is a 34.98m motor yacht for sale built by Italian shipyard Admiral Yachts. The yacht's exteriors have been penned by LUCA DINI Design & Architecture, while Magazzini Associati has designed her interiors.

Design & Construction
Designed around a deep vee aluminium hull and superstructure she features a 7.4m beam and a 2.4m draft. The yacht is built over 2 decks with an internal volume of 214 GT (Gross Tonnes).
Exterior Design
The exterior of Anavi comes from Luca Dini and carries the sharp, low-profile look typical of Admiral fast motor yachts from the period. Built entirely in aluminium with a deep-V planing hull, the yacht combines aggressive proportions with long horizontal lines and a notably lean superstructure for a 36.1m (118.5ft) yacht.
The bow has a fine, pointed entry with minimal overhang, so the profile keeps a very clean forward shape while underway. Dark glazing stretches almost continuously along the main deck, visually lowering the profile and contrasting against the metallic silver hull. The flybridge structure sits low and swept back beneath a compact radar arch, which helps preserve the yacht’s streamlined appearance even with the upper deck fully developed.
Outdoor living areas are arranged across several levels. The flybridge functions as a large open-air solarium with space for sun loungers, relaxed seating, and dining beneath a Bimini top. Aft, the cockpit offers another social area close to the water, while wide side decks connect the guest spaces efficiently from stern to bow.
One of the yacht’s most unusual exterior features is the forward gym installation. Instead of using the foredeck garage purely for water toys, the area was developed into an open-air fitness zone in collaboration with Angelo Caroli. A carbon-steel canopy lifts up to 3m (9.8ft) above the deck, creating ventilation and open sky views during workouts.
The exterior design also reflects the yacht’s performance focus. Lightweight aluminium construction, clean deck architecture, and the deep-V hull all support higher cruising speeds, with Anavi capable of reaching 28 knots from her twin MTU 12V 4000 M90 engines.
Accommodation
Anavi offers accommodation for up to 8 guests in 4 suites comprising an owners cabin, 1 double cabin and 2 twin cabins. She is also capable of carrying up to 6 crew onboard to ensure a relaxed luxury yacht experience.
Performance & Capabilities
Powered by twin diesel MTU (12V 4000 M90) 2,890hp engines, motor yacht Anavi is capable of reaching a top speed of 28 knots, and comfortably cruises at 24 knots. With her 22,000 litre fuel tanks she has a maximum range of 3,500 nautical miles at 13 knots. She has been fitted with stabilizers to increase on-board comfort when the yacht is at anchor, particularly in rough waters.
Amenities
The yacht features a well-equipped gym, allowing her guests to keep up their fitness regimes at sea. The yacht features a tender garage with storage for a range of toys and accessories.
